Writing pandas dataframe to CSV with decimal places, How to Round the Index of a Data Frame in Pandas. WebRound off values of column to two decimal place in pandas dataframe. To round the values in a column to a specific number of decimal places, simply specify that value in the round() function. Also note that the values in the other numeric column, points, have remained unchanged. 15.8 has been rounded to 15.80. What are examples of software that may be seriously affected by a time jump? Next let's cover how to round down a column in Python and Pandas. How far does travel insurance cover stretch? Webpandas-dataframe-round Examples In [1]: import numpy as np import pandas as pd In [2]: df = pd.DataFrame( [ (.24, .34), (.02, .70), (.64, .04), (.24, .20)], columns=['deers', 'goats']) df Out [2]: By providing an integer each column is rounded to the same number of decimal places: In [3]: df.round(1) Out [3]: To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Rachmaninoff C# minor prelude: towards the end, staff lines are joined together, and there are two end markings. First lets create the dataframe import pandas as pd import numpy as np #Create a DataFrame df1 = { We want only two decimal places in column A. . Get statistics for each group (such as count, mean, etc) using pandas GroupBy? Python Programming Foundation -Self Paced Course, Python | Pandas DataFrame.fillna() to replace Null values in dataframe, Replace values of a DataFrame with the value of another DataFrame in Pandas, Ceil and floor of the dataframe in Pandas Python Round up and Truncate, Mapping external values to dataframe values in Pandas, Highlight the negative values red and positive values black in Pandas Dataframe, Difference Between Spark DataFrame and Pandas DataFrame, Convert given Pandas series into a dataframe with its index as another column on the dataframe. Output :Example #2: Use round() function to round off all the columns in dataframe to different places. rev2023.2.28.43265. Set decimal precision of a pandas dataframe column with a datatype of Decimal, The open-source game engine youve been waiting for: Godot (Ep. which rounds off the values of a vector to two decimal places 1 2 3 # round function in R with 2 decimal places for a vector round(c(1.234,2.342,4.562,5.671,12.345,14.567),digits = 2) output: [1] 1.23 2.34 4.56 5.67 12.35 14.57 Round off multiple columns to decimal values in pandas dataframe, The open-source game engine youve been waiting for: Godot (Ep. Pandas Series.round () method is used in such cases only to round of decimal values in series. Not the answer you're looking for? We briefly described rounding up and down. We can use the following code to round each value in the, #round values in 'time' column of DataFrame, To round the values in a column to a specific number of decimal places, simply specify that value in the, For example, we can use the following code to round each value in the, #round values in 'time' column to two decimal places. Any Web2 For those that come here not because wanted to round the DataFrame but merely want to limit the displayed value to n decimal places, use pd.set_option instead. A-143, 9th Floor, Sovereign Corporate Tower, We use cookies to ensure you have the best browsing experience on our website. Python Numpy round to 2 decimal places Let us see how to get the rounded number in the NumPy array by using Python. rev2023.2.28.43265. How to iterate over rows in a DataFrame in Pandas. import pandas as pd sheets_dict = pd.read_excel('Book1.xlsx', sheetname=None) full_table = pd.DataFrame() for name, sheet in sheets_dict.items(): sheet['sheet'] = name sheet = sheet.rename(columns=lambda x: x.split('\n') [-1]) full_table = full_table.append(sheet) full_table.reset_index(inplace =True, drop=True) print full_table Pandas Dataframe.to_numpy() - Convert dataframe to Numpy array. You can then use the fourth approach to round the values under all the columns that contain numeric values in the DataFrame: And this is the code that you can use for our example: Youll see that the values are now rounded to 2 decimal places across the 2 columns that contained the numeric data: Alternatively, you can get the same results using NumPy: We use technologies like cookies to store and/or access device information. Connect and share knowledge within a single location that is structured and easy to search. Can we use round() to convert int datatype? Would the reflected sun's radiation melt ice in LEO? How to iterate over rows in a DataFrame in Pandas, Combine two columns of text in pandas dataframe, Get a list from Pandas DataFrame column headers. Python is a great language for doing data analysis, primarily because of the fantastic ecosystem of data-centric python packages. This function provides the flexibility to round different columns by different places. In your use case, you can use the following syntax to round the dictionary The technical storage or access that is used exclusively for anonymous statistical purposes. You can use the function round(variable,number_of_decimal_places) to round variables. What are the consequences of overstaying in the Schengen area by 2 hours? Number of decimal places Each value in the time column has been rounded to two decimal places. WebCode: Python. 542), We've added a "Necessary cookies only" option to the cookie consent popup.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, the .round function does not work, it gives an error TypeError: unsupported operand type(s) for *: 'decimal.Decimal' and 'float'. Why do we kill some animals but not others? Connect and share knowledge within a single location that is structured and easy to search. First letter in argument of "\affil" not being output if the first letter is "L". By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. import pandas as pd import numpy as np df = pd.read_csv decimal places as value.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Suppose were dealing with a DataFrame df that looks something like this.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. what if I only want to round numerical columns (without specifying the name of the column)? Alternate between 0 and 180 shift at regular intervals for a sine source during a .tran operation on LTspice. hubris vr download. A B 0 0.1111 0.22 1 0.3333 0.44 We want only two decimal places in column A. How to Show All Rows of a Pandas DataFrame columns not included in decimals will be left as is. It works just the same as ROUND, except that it always rounds a number up. Launching the CI/CD and R Collectives and community editing features for rounding off columns to two decimal place, Show DataFrame as table in iPython Notebook, Unable to convert pandas dataframe into 2 decimal places, how to change the values in column to positive and roundoff to single decimal point using pandas, How to round a number to n decimal places in Java. By providing an integer each column is rounded to the same number document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); Statology is a site that makes learning statistics easy by explaining topics in simple and straightforward ways. Number of decimal places to round each column to. Suppose that you have a dataset which contains the following values (with varying-length decimal places): You can then create a DataFrame to capture those values in Python: The DataFrame would look like this in Python: Lets say that your goal is to round the values to 3 decimals places. How to Check dtype for All Columns in Pandas DataFrame, Your email address will not be published. But in the result i could still see .0. For those that come here not because wanted to round the DataFrame but merely want to limit the displayed value to n decimal places, use pd.set_ How do I make a flat list out of a list of lists? We do this to improve browsing experience and to show personalized ads. upgrading to decora light switches- why left switch has white and black wire backstabbed? By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. rev2023.2.28.43265. Column names should be in the keys if To accomplish this goal, you can use the fourth approach below. Launching the CI/CD and R Collectives and community editing features for How to deal with pip values (trading) in Python? Round down values under a s ingle DataFrame column. If I flipped a coin 5 times (a head=1 and a tails=-1), what would the absolute value of the result be on average? These methods are used to round values to floorvalue(largest integer value smaller than particular value). This methods will make all printed DataFrame on your notebook follow the option. Why does RSASSA-PSS rely on full collision resistance whereas RSA-PSS only relies on target collision resistance? Show results from. places as value, Using a Series, the number of places for specific columns can be Selecting multiple columns in a Pandas dataframe, Filter pandas DataFrame by substring criteria. Am I being scammed after paying almost $10,000 to a tree company not being able to withdraw my profit without paying a fee. decimal places in pandas pandas dataframe float 2 decimals df.round () pandas rounding pandas trunc number rounding in pandas pandas digits round values in column pandas round up pandas series round all columns pandas float to 2 decimals round df columns how to round off pandas pandas round mean pandas dataframe round values Method 2: Using Dataframe.apply() and numpy.ceil() together. Pandas is one of those packages and makes importing and analyzing data much easier. import pandas as pd Get started with our course today. Background - float type cant store all decimal numbers exactly For numbers with a decimal separator, by default Python uses float and Pandas uses numpy float64. This method can be used to roundvalue to specific decimal places for any particular column or can also be used to round the value of the entire data frame to the specific number of decimal places. Draw Spiraling Triangle using Turtle in Python. To generate random float numbers in Python and Pandas we can use the following code: Generating N random float numbers in Python: Next we will create DataFrame from the above data: Let's start by rounding specific column up to 2 decimal places. 542), We've added a "Necessary cookies only" option to the cookie consent popup. Lets use numpy random function to achieve the task. decimalsint, default 0. Launching the CI/CD and R Collectives and community editing features for How to round a number to n decimal places in Java, Selecting multiple columns in a Pandas dataframe, How to round to at most 2 decimal places, if necessary, Use a list of values to select rows from a Pandas dataframe. Syntax:DataFrame.round(decimals=0, *args, **kwargs)Parameters :decimals : Number of decimal places to round each column to. Making statements based on opinion; back them up with references or personal experience. Can patents be featured/explained in a youtube video i.e. Internally float types use a base 2 representation which is convenient for binary Any columns not included in decimals will be left as is. Also note that the values in the other numeric column, How to Subtract Hours from Time in R (With Examples), How to Change Column Type in Pandas (With Examples). Suspicious referee report, are "suggested citations" from a paper mill? round ({'Y': 2, 'X': 2}) Out [661]: Y X id WP_NER 0 35.97-2.73 1 WP_01 1 35.59-2.90 2 WP_02 2 35.33-3.39 3 WP_03 3 35.39-3.93 WebSeries.round(decimals=0, *args, **kwargs) [source] #. The following tutorials explain how to perform other common operations in pandas: How to Print Pandas DataFrame with No Index Here are 4 ways to round values in Pandas DataFrame: (1) Round to specific decimal places under a single DataFrame column, (2) Round up values under a single DataFrame column, (3) Round down values under a single DataFrame column, (4) Round to specific decimals places under an entire DataFrame. Column names should be in the keys if decimals is a dict-like, or in the index if decimals is a Series. To learn more, see our tips on writing great answers. 3.3. Hosted by OVHcloud. Learn more about us. Can an overly clever Wizard work around the AL restrictions on True Polymorph? Is quantile regression a maximum likelihood method? of decimal places, With a dict, the number of places for specific columns can be I don't know exactly when it is changed, but version 1.5.1 and later use 'display.precision' instead of 'precision': Read more at: https://numpy.org/doc/stable/reference/generated/numpy.set_printoptions.html. Return: An arraywith the floor of each element. Thanks for contributing an answer to Stack Overflow! Probably there is a straight way using decimal, but I don't know the answer. that comes from the fact that a cell value can be a string or a NAN. Example: Rounding off the value of the DATA ENTRY column up to 2 decimalplaces. WebIf an int is given, round each column to the same number of places. 1 . For example, we can use the following code to round each value in the time column to two decimal places: Each value in the time column has been rounded to two decimal places. Of `` \affil '' not being output if the first letter in argument of `` \affil not! Do n't know the Answer rows of a pandas DataFrame columns not included in decimals will be left is. To two decimal places, how to Check dtype for all columns in to! Together, and there are two end markings, you agree to our terms service. To 2 decimal places each value in the time column has been rounded two. Down a column in Python result I could still see.0 Example 2... With a DataFrame df that looks something like this lets use numpy random to! The first letter in argument of `` \affil '' not being output if the first letter argument. Looks something like this places to round down values under a s ingle DataFrame pandas round column to 2 decimal places language... Not being output if the first letter is `` L '' rows of a pandas DataFrame different. Video i.e like this would the reflected sun 's radiation melt ice in LEO joined,... Being able to withdraw my profit without paying a fee email address will not be published features for to. Dict-Like, or in the Schengen area by 2 hours the values in series Corporate. For all columns in DataFrame to different places suspicious referee report, are `` suggested citations '' from paper. Python is a dict-like, or in the other numeric column, points, have remained unchanged ice in?! Source during a.tran operation on LTspice white pandas round column to 2 decimal places black wire backstabbed to round different columns by places. Number_Of_Decimal_Places ) to round each column to the cookie consent popup technologists share private knowledge with coworkers, Reach &. Achieve the task minor prelude: towards the end, staff lines are joined together, and there are end! Of software that may be seriously affected by a time jump to our terms service. 'S radiation melt ice in LEO you agree to our terms of service privacy. Straight way using decimal, but I do n't know the Answer operation on.... A tree company not being output if the first letter in argument of `` \affil '' being... Prelude: towards the end, staff lines are joined together, and there are end. To CSV with decimal places, how to get the rounded number in other! Each group ( such as count, mean, etc ) using pandas GroupBy, but I do n't the... Whereas RSA-PSS only relies on target collision resistance decimal, but I do n't the... Column, points, have remained unchanged to 2 decimalplaces using Python the... Pd.Read_Csv decimal places in column a the first letter in argument of `` \affil '' being... Each value in the time column has been rounded to two decimal places each in! Smaller than particular value ) pandas DataFrame columns not included in decimals will be left as is experience to... The flexibility to round each column to the same number of decimal places at regular intervals for a sine during!, points, have remained unchanged data analysis, primarily because of the data ENTRY column up to 2 places... Up with references or personal experience for each group ( such as count, mean, etc ) using GroupBy... Entry column up to 2 decimalplaces Show all rows of a pandas DataFrame binary! I being scammed after paying almost $ 10,000 to a tree company not being output if first. 180 shift at regular intervals for a sine source during a.tran operation on LTspice decimal place in DataFrame. Technologists share private knowledge with coworkers, Reach developers & technologists share private knowledge with,. Looks something like this that comes from the fact that a cell value can be a or! Cookies to ensure you have the best browsing experience and to Show personalized ads affected by a time?... The other numeric column, points, have remained unchanged a single location that is structured easy... Personalized ads convert int datatype referee report, are `` suggested citations '' from paper... Structured and easy to search of overstaying in the time column has been rounded to two decimal place pandas. 1 0.3333 0.44 We pandas round column to 2 decimal places only two decimal places as value number_of_decimal_places ) to int..., or in the numpy array by using Python single location that is structured and easy to search one those... Rounding off the value of the data ENTRY column up to 2 places. Note that the values in the other numeric column, points, have remained unchanged RSASSA-PSS on! Are examples of software that may be seriously affected by a time jump in and... R Collectives and community editing features for how to Check dtype for columns. Restrictions on True Polymorph output: Example # 2: use round ( ) function to round of values! Not be published importing and analyzing data much easier packages and makes importing and analyzing data much easier switch. Or personal experience 2 decimalplaces Reach developers & technologists share private knowledge with coworkers Reach... Rows of a data Frame in pandas be a string or a NAN the.! Internally float types use a base 2 representation which is convenient for binary Any not! Than particular value ) writing great answers methods are used to round variables radiation! Int datatype the values in series all rows of a pandas DataFrame columns not included decimals! '' from a paper mill these methods are used to round of decimal places each value in the time has! Share knowledge within pandas round column to 2 decimal places single location that is structured and easy to search 180 shift at regular intervals a... Columns ( without specifying the name of the fantastic ecosystem of data-centric packages! On writing great answers two end markings number up by 2 hours I only to... Only '' option to the cookie consent popup DataFrame, Your email address will not be published a base representation! Able to withdraw my profit without paying a fee black wire backstabbed of. ( largest integer value smaller than particular value ) collision resistance whereas RSA-PSS only relies on collision! Just the same number of decimal values in the result I could still see.! Some animals but not others printed DataFrame on Your notebook follow the option except that it rounds. Am I being scammed after paying almost $ 10,000 to a tree company not being output the! Let 's cover how to iterate over rows in a DataFrame df that looks something like this to more... Full collision resistance whereas RSA-PSS only relies on target collision resistance 0.3333 0.44 We only! Cookies only '' option to the same as round, except that it always a. Rsassa-Pss rely on full collision resistance an overly clever Wizard work around the pandas round column to 2 decimal places restrictions True... A s ingle DataFrame column Tower, We use cookies to ensure you have the best browsing experience to. Making statements based on opinion ; back them up with references or personal experience the value of the ENTRY. Types use a base 2 representation which is convenient for binary Any columns not included in decimals will left... The reflected sun 's radiation melt ice in LEO Python numpy round to 2 decimal places each value in other. Area by 2 hours, staff lines are joined together, and there two... Use round ( ) function to round variables location that is structured and to! Let 's cover how to Show personalized ads cover how to round off all the in. Under a s ingle DataFrame column the best browsing experience on our website column a etc ) pandas! As value the value of the column ) to get the rounded number in the result could. Based on opinion ; back them up with references or personal experience the end, staff are. Looks something like this email address will not be published `` L '' a! Makes importing and analyzing data much easier data ENTRY column up to 2 decimal to... Report, are `` suggested citations '' from a paper mill Your email address will not be.... You can use the function round ( ) method is used in cases! ) function to achieve the task to a tree company not being able to withdraw my profit paying... Import pandas as pd import numpy as np df = pd.read_csv decimal places column... Value can be a string or a NAN a base 2 representation which is convenient for Any! Ecosystem of data-centric Python packages ( such as count, mean, etc ) using pandas GroupBy get with. Rachmaninoff C # minor prelude: towards the end, staff lines are joined together, there. Round of decimal places in column a using pandas GroupBy the same as round, pandas round column to 2 decimal places that always... And there are two end markings analyzing data much easier ingle DataFrame column be featured/explained in a DataFrame in DataFrame! On opinion ; pandas round column to 2 decimal places them up with references or personal experience Index of data. Our tips on writing great answers variable, number_of_decimal_places ) to round values floorvalue! Resistance whereas RSA-PSS only relies on target collision resistance \affil '' not being able to withdraw my without! More, see our tips on writing great answers based on opinion ; back them with! Straight way using decimal, but I do n't know the Answer other questions tagged, Where &! We kill some animals but not others our tips on writing great answers be... Want only two decimal place in pandas DataFrame, Your email address will not be published a in... Doing data analysis, primarily because of the column ) there is series! Int datatype been rounded to two decimal place in pandas DataFrame to CSV with decimal places how! Upgrading to decora light switches- why left switch has white and black wire backstabbed same!
Justin Smith Obituary,
Jan Burres Son,
Helm Mechanical Illinois,
World Longest Squat Hold,
Articles P
Ми передаємо опіку за вашим здоров’ям кваліфікованим вузькоспеціалізованим лікарям, які мають великий стаж (до 20 років). Серед персоналу є доктора медичних наук, що доводить високий статус клініки. Використовуються традиційні методи діагностики та лікування, а також спеціальні методики, розроблені кожним лікарем. Індивідуальні програми діагностики та лікування.
При високому рівні якості наші послуги залишаються доступними відносно їхньої вартості. Ціни, порівняно з іншими клініками такого ж рівня, є помітно нижчими. Повторні візити коштуватимуть менше. Таким чином, ви без проблем можете дозволити собі повний курс лікування або діагностики, планової або екстреної.
Клініка зручно розташована відносно транспортної розв’язки у центрі міста. Кабінети облаштовані згідно зі світовими стандартами та вимогами. Нове обладнання, в тому числі апарати УЗІ, відрізняється високою надійністю та точністю. Гарантується уважне відношення та беззаперечна лікарська таємниця.